Glasgow is a fantastic place to be at Christmas, I love the atmosphere, the lights, everything. There is always a wonderful, festive buzz around the city. Visiting the Christmas Market in St. Enoch Square is one of my favorite things to do at this time of the year. I love browsing the stalls for festive trinkets while sipping on a mulled wine and sampling some of the delicious continental food. (Churros mmm...) I also have to miss my office Christmas meal this year but I'm planning on a trip to Glasgow's Chaophraya for a lovely treat when I'm back on my feet again.


Since I'm stuck at home I'll be doing most of my shopping online this year but if you are still to do yours then The Style Mile has some of Glasgow's best shopping. You'll be spoiled for choice at the Buchanan Galleries, St. Enoch Centre and Princes Square centres, or if getting everything in the one place is more your thing why not try a department store? House of Fraser, John Lewis or Debenhams are all jam packed with Christmas gifts. If you are looking to get an extra special piece of jewelry for that special someone then Argyll Arcade is where you need to be.


Another winter favorite of mine is to visit George Square. The square is probably the most festive area in the city and is packed with fairground rides,  and a massive outdoor ice rink.
